Meeting discusses solid waste management system for Mangan

GANGTOK, 27 Aug: As directed by Forest Minister, a preliminary meeting to set up a system for solid waste management was held in the office of the District Collector, North on Tuesday. Representatives from Forest Department, Mangan Nagar Panchayat and UD&HD were present in meeting.
A press release informs that during the meeting different aspects on setting up of a system of solid waste management and integration of same with segregation of waste at source and converting green waste to organic manure duly involving the local communities were discussed. The system is proposed to be set up near Mangan jointly by Mangan Nagar Panchayat, Forest Department and NHPC through District Collectorate, North with an objective to make Mangan Bazar and nearby places/villages garbage free.
The project would look into collection, segregation and treatment of garbage. The garbage would be converted into organic manure and revenue would be generated by selling the same in the market.
It may be pertinent to mention that during the year 2013 NHPC had agreed and assured area MLA, Tshering Wangdi Lepcha of funding a project for garbage management at Mangan. After the meeting the team also inspected the Organic Waste Converting Shed presently being managed by Mangan Nagar Panchayat at a small scale. The plant is not able to cater to the growing need of Mangan bazaar and surrounding areas hence the large scale garbage treatment plant is the need-of-the-hour.
Next co-ordination meeting is scheduled to be held on 30 August at DAC, Mangan with PCCF-cum-Principal Secretary, Forest, and other officials from the Forest Department, Pollution Control Board, NHPC and District Administration, North District for swift initiation of the project.
